当前位置: 代码迷 >> VC/MFC >> 请问:C++ 能利用WiFi获取GPS吗?还是只能从串口中读取
  详细解决方案

请问:C++ 能利用WiFi获取GPS吗?还是只能从串口中读取

热度:178   发布时间:2016-05-02 03:46:44.0
请教:C++ 能利用WiFi获取GPS吗?还是只能从串口中读取?
就是已知WiFi的SSID、IP地址、端口号。能用mfc获取到GPS信息吗?gprmc
似乎安卓就是这么做的。PC端可以做到吗?
------解决思路----------------------
按我的理解,获取GPS位置和网络关系不大,模块通过微波接收数据,然后写串口或者其他方式导出。你安卓手机上首先是装了GPS模块,才能定位。当然,应该也有通过网络运营商(或者是基站?)定位,具体没做过不了解。
------解决思路----------------------
我想楼主还没搞清楚如何得到GPS数据的吧?
它需要GPS模块硬件支持,不是有了WIFI就能读出的,建议先学习一下相关知识。
------解决思路----------------------
肯定可以,但是你的GPS部分必须具备wifi的能力

GPS获取地理信息
GPS部件必须具备TCP/ip协议栈,能通过Socket发送数据
GPS部件必须具备wifi转换功能,soket数据流能通过wifi传输
------解决思路----------------------
可以先研究下 Andriod 的 定位方法

android 定位的几种方式介绍
  相关解决方案